remote
IAM Engineer - McKesson
Software Engineer
IAM Engineer responsible for designing, implementing, and maintaining identity and access management solutions using Azure AD, Okta, SAML and automation scripts, ensuring secure access across cloud and on‑premise environments.
About the role
Key Responsibilities
- Design, configure, and manage IAM platforms such as Azure AD and Okta to support enterprise authentication and authorization.
- Develop and maintain automated provisioning/de‑provisioning workflows using Python and scripting tools.
- Implement and troubleshoot SAML, OAuth, and LDAP integrations for internal and third‑party applications.
- Monitor access controls, conduct regular audits, and remediate security findings to ensure compliance with industry standards.
- Collaborate with security, infrastructure, and application teams to define IAM policies and support cloud migration initiatives.
Requirements
- 3+ years of hands‑on experience with Identity and Access Management solutions (Azure AD, Okta, SAML, LDAP).
- Proficiency in Python or similar scripting languages for automation and API integration.
- Strong understanding of cloud security concepts and experience with AWS or Azure environments.
- Demonstrated ability to analyze complex access requirements and translate them into scalable technical solutions.
- Excellent problem‑solving skills, proactive mindset, and ability to work cross‑functionally.